Germany Ultra High Molecular Weight Polyethylene Market Overview
As per MRFR analysis, the Germany Ultra High Molecular Weight Polyethylene Market Size was estimated at 86.7 (USD Million) in 2023.The Germany Ultra High Molecular Weight Polyethylene Market Industry is expected to grow from 92.04(USD Million) in 2024 to 387.05 (USD Million) by 2035. The Germany Ultra High Molecular Weight Polyethylene Market CAGR (growth rate) is expected to be around 13.948% during the forecast period (2025 - 2035)

Germany Ultra High Molecular Weight Polyethylene Market Drivers
Growing Demand from Healthcare Sector
The healthcare sector in Germany has been witnessing substantial growth, driven by an aging population and increased investments in medical technology. According to the Federal Statistical Office of Germany, the population aged 65 and over is projected to reach approximately 23 million by 2035, which significantly increases the demand for advanced medical equipment and devices. Ultra High Molecular Weight Polyethylene (UHMWPE) is extensively used in orthopedic implants, surgical instruments, and other medical devices due to its excellent biocompatibility and wear resistance.The growing presences of firms like B. Braun Melsungen AG and Fresenius SE, which are constantly innovating and collaborating on new medical technologies, directly influence the expansion of the Germany Ultra High Molecular Weight Polyethylene Market Industry. As the healthcare sector continues to evolve, the reliance on high-performance materials like UHMWPE is expected to rise, fueling the market's growth.
Increased Application in Industrial Manufacturing
The industrial manufacturing sector in Germany is focusing on improving efficiency and reducing production costs, which has led to a notable increase in the adoption of advanced materials like Ultra High Molecular Weight Polyethylene. The German Engineering Federation (VDMA) indicated that the country’s machinery and equipment sector has grown by approximately 6% in recent years, showcasing a robust demand for high-performance materials. Moreover, UHMWPE's impact resistance and low friction properties have made it ideal for components in conveyor systems, gears, and bearings used within various manufacturing processes.
This demand surge from the industrial sector is further supported by established organizations such as Siemens AG and ThyssenKrupp AG, which actively seek innovative materials that enhance productivity. As these companies adapt to modern manufacturing trends, the market for Germany Ultra High Molecular Weight Polyethylene Market will continue to expand.

Ultra High Molecular Weight Polyethylene Market Type Insights
The Germany Ultra High Molecular Weight Polyethylene Market is witnessing notable developments across various types, responding to increased demand driven by sectors like automotive, healthcare, and industrial applications. The Standard Reinforced UHMW-PE type is highly regarded for its strength and durability, making it essential in applications requiring high impact resistance. The Conductive/Anti-Static UHMW-PE type caters to industries where static control is critical, particularly in electronic components, thus facilitating safer operations.Lubricated UHMW-PE plays a pivotal role in reducing friction and wear in moving parts, finding relevance in conveyor systems and machinery.
Cross Linked UHMW-PE is recognized for its enhanced performance characteristics, such as improved toughness and heat resistance, which are valuable in demanding environments. Other variants in the market capitalize on specific performance needs and are increasingly tailored to meet custom applications. Ultra High Molecular Weight Polyethylene Market Application Insights
The Application segment of the Germany Ultra High Molecular Weight Polyethylene Market encompasses a diverse range of industries, showcasing its versatility and robustness. In the Aerospace Defense sector, the material’s high strength-to-weight ratio and wear resistance make it essential for components subjected to demanding conditions. The Marine industry leverages its corrosion resistance, contributing to enhanced durability in harsh environments. In the Healthcare Medical field, the biocompatibility and low friction properties of Ultra High Molecular Weight Polyethylene are pivotal in surgical applications and implants, positioning it as a staple in medical innovations.Additionally, the Food Beverages industry benefits from its hygienic properties, making it suitable for applications requiring strict sanitary standards.
The Automotive sector utilizes Ultra High Molecular Weight Polyethylene for parts that demand high-performance characteristics, playing a significant role in the continuous evolution of vehicle components.
